Job Description

The PDMB Regulated Bioanalytics Department is seeking a Senior Robotics Engineer to join our Regulated Robotics group. This role will support work across groups within the Regulated Bioanalytics Department, including work at our company’s new state-of-the-art AdVAnce GxP research facility in West Point, PA. At this new facility, we will combine the power of innovative robotics, IT platforms, and science to accelerate multiple modalities and enable late-stage clinical trials through the generation of timely, high-quality regulated bioanalytical data.

The selected individual will provide excellent automation and operational support to our scientific partners. Specifically, the individual will be responsible for the set up and operation of state-of-the-art, end-to-end laboratory automation systems. This individual will provide high level automation and engineering support, troubleshooting, and assist in the design and fabrication of components to support the clinical research environment. The individual must also have the mindset to sustain and operate the systems they have helped build and organize.

Education Minimum Requirement
  • BA/BS in Engineering, Biotechnology, Computer Science or equivalent with at least 7 years, MS with at least 3 years, or PhD with hands‑on experience in related field
Responsibilities
Liquid Handling / Automation Integration
  • Program and integrate laboratory instrumentation from vendors such as Beckman Coulter, Hamilton, Tecan etc.
  • Develop and optimize liquid handling protocols on Biomek/Hamilton/Tecan as well as perform liquid class validation
  • Coordinate with vendors to support and service equipment to minimize down time
  • Responsible for operations, troubleshooting, and optimization of novel robotic platforms
Team Interface
  • Act collaboratively to solve problems and resolve new and unique situations with professionalism and service orientation
  • Provide timely scientific support to assay staff while maintaining project timelines
  • Empower, coach, and grow our scientific partners as they transfer their experiments to robotic platforms
Project Support
  • Procure material required for assay execution, system builds, and general laboratory support
  • Develop and execute installation, testing, and validation procedures on novel automation platforms
  • Coordinate installation requirements with Safety and Facilities
Process Optimization
  • Seek to continuously improve processes, systems, and overall client satisfaction
  • Provide direction/information to vendors, suppliers, facilities staff, and service providers as required, ensuring excellent coordination/execution of work within the client environment with minimal disruption, as needed
